The Farmers' Exchange Company ~)EG to Intimate that they have this day ME BEN JONAS The Business of AUCTIONEERS AND GENERAL MERCHANTS, % lately carried on by them in Beswick Street, Timaru, who will conduct the Business in the Premises lately occupied by them. lEFERRING to the above, I beg to intimate that I will carry on the Business of AUCTIONEER, VALUATOR, AND GENERAL COMMISSION AGENT, In the Old Established Premises, Beswick Street, lately occupied by the FARMERS' EXCHANGE COMPANY, and will be glad to receive Consignments of all classes'of PRODUCE, FURNITURE, GENERAL MERCHANDISE, ETC., which will always be disposed of to the Best Advantage. Buyers are notified that the Business will be conducted on STRICTLY CASH LINES, and Account Sales will be Promptly Rendered. BEN JONAS, Auctioneer. March Ist, 1902.
